Long-Term Holdouts and Effect Decay
By the end of this lesson, you should be able to: tell decay from a permanent gain, say when a holdout can first rule out pure novelty, size a holdout against what it costs, and name the reason a long-running holdout stops being valid.
The same experiment, read at different times
Meridian launches a loyalty programme to 80% of riders and holds 20% back. Trips per user, treated against holdout:
| Read at | Measured lift | Versus the 26-week answer |
|---|---|---|
| Week 1 | +10.2% | 4.2x |
| Weeks 1-2 | +9.1% | 3.8x |
| Weeks 1-4 | +7.5% | 3.1x |
| Weeks 5-8 | +4.3% | 1.8x |
| Weeks 13-16 | +2.8% | 1.2x |
| Weeks 23-26 | +2.5% | 1.0x |
Every one of those numbers is a correct measurement of a real randomised comparison. They differ because the effect itself changed, not because any of them was computed wrongly.
A team that ran two weeks, saw +9.1%, and put that in the annual plan has booked roughly four times the value the feature delivers. The two-week readout contains no signal that this will happen.

Decay or dilution
Here's the distinction that decides what you do, and the reason a holdout has to keep running.
A novelty effect decays to nothing. Users tried the loyalty programme because it was new, the interest wore off, and the long-run value is zero. Ship it and you've added maintenance for nothing.
A real effect that settles decays to a smaller, permanent level. The initial spike was novelty on top of a genuine gain. Ship it and you get 2.4% forever.
Those two stories look nearly identical early:
| Week | Measured | If it decays to zero | If it settles at 2.4% |
|---|---|---|---|
| 1 | +10.2% | +9.0% | +9.0% |
| 2 | +8.1% | +7.2% | +7.7% |
| 3 | +6.8% | +5.8% | +6.6% |
| 6 | +4.7% | +3.0% | +4.6% |
| 10 | +2.9% | +1.2% | +3.3% |
| 18 | +3.2% | +0.2% | +2.6% |
| 26 | +2.7% | +0.0% | +2.4% |
At week 3 the two stories differ by 0.8 points and no measurement can separate them. By week 18 they differ by the entire remaining effect.
That gap is what the extra fifteen weeks of holdout bought. It is not precision on a number you already had; it is the difference between "ship it" and "delete it".
